Google is ushering in the new year with some helpful Chrome upgrades for more secure and speedy browsing. Updates rolling out over the next few weeks aim to keep your data safe while streamlining tab organization.
Let’s explore the key improvements making their way to your browser.
Proactive Safety Warnings
Chrome’s new Safety Check runs automatic scans to warn you of potential issues like compromised passwords, outdated software versions, or suspicious permission requests. Monitor the menu dropdown for alerts.
Smarter Memory Management
The Memory Saver feature now displays the exact RAM usage for each open tab. This allows intelligently unloading heavy tabs to reclaim system resources and speed up overall Chrome performance when needed.
Tab Group Continuity
Soon you’ll be able to save tab groups to retain your browsing session setup across devices. Access research projects seamlessly from desktop to laptop without losing your place.
